Runbook — Fernwood validator plugins. Welcome! Validators live in the plugins/ dir and register themselves at startup; if one throws during load, the whole pipeline skips it and logs a warning, so check logs first. To add one, copy the template plugin and bump the manifest version. Always confirm the loader build, whose token is printed below.

trace token, fafog-kageg: htk4_98e6

Migration step 4 (Varnholt telemetry): enable zstd compression on outbound payloads before switching the collector to the v2 schema. Verify compressed batches decode cleanly in staging, and confirm the ingest worker's CPU headroom stays under 60%. Once validated, point the ingest worker at the compressed-events database using the connection string that follows.

primary connection of yagep-kahip = redis://giliel_svc:zYiKsLL2PLpfPL@db-348f.xolmarsys.corp:5432/fenwyn

[ ] Donation-receipt mailer signing — Whistlecreek Giving. New folks: this is the key ceremony step where we rotate the signing key for the receipt PDFs donors get. Two people in the room, screens locked, no phones out. Confirm the mailer queue is drained before rotating, or half the receipts go out with the old signature. To open the ceremony vault, enter the passphrase below.

strongbox words: ulaael-wenix

Alert: GH-Drift-14 fired twice this week on the Fernvale greenhouse controllers. The humidity sensors in bays 3 and 7 are drifting roughly 4% per day against the reference probes, likely due to the aging Calyx-2 modules. Auto-calibration masks the drift until it exceeds the 12% guardrail, at which point the Verdanix control loop overcorrects vent positions. We've flagged affected units and paused fertigation overrides. Questions or recalibration requests should go to the sensors on-call inbox.

alerts address for yajof-kahog: eliax@qirvanlabs.corp

Subject: Autocomplete index latency — what new folks should know

Team, a quick note for anyone who joined recently: the Seabright autocomplete index has been rebuilding slowly since the schema migration last week. Suggestions may lag by up to four seconds during peak hours. This is known and tracked; the fix ships in the next release train. If users report it, log the occurrence and reference the affected build, which is noted below.

session token of tajog-fahaf = htk21_4ae55819f45410afcb307